Output ac7885091afcd6cb664163920b9ee4a7a108bc91886b7a68cbd2d374f9eeaff3:3

value
420848928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b41ee173d9a15593a79e7ced21f48d95c46eafa6 OP_EQUALVERIFY OP_CHECKSIG
address
1HRPdA4rkf3vhfkMaCmBB8yK1o1gX6wL82
transaction
ac7885091afcd6cb664163920b9ee4a7a108bc91886b7a68cbd2d374f9eeaff3
spent
true